If sin x=-3/5 and sec x>0, find all the other circular function values of x

sin x=-3/5 and sec x>0 ---> sin x=-3/5 and cos x>0
so your angle must be in quadrants IV
If you sketch your triangle , you will realize that you are dealing with the 3-4-5 right-angled triangle, and using the CAST rule
sinx = -3/5 , cscx = -5/3
cosx = 4/5, secx = 5/4
tanx = -3/4, cotx = -4/3
